I bought an  8x11 foot remnant of carpet for may car. We will have to wait to put it in until we have a parts car with the original carpet so we can use it as a stencil for my new carpet. Today, I also made a face plate adapter for the stereo I am putting in my car. I used 1/4 inch plywood. I painted it with flat black spray paint and then I sealed it with clear gloss polyurethane. I still need to put a second coat of polyurethane on.

I got an idea to add cup holders to my center console cover to give my car some more functionality. So, I used a 3-inch hole saw and drilled 2 cup holes. Then I put on another coat of polyurethane.

March 29, 2011

I made a frame out of oak for the bottom of the center console cover so it will stay in place when sitting on the center console. 

March 28, 2011

I stained the oak with Minwax Cherry 235. Then I sealed it with clear gloss polyurethane.

March 27, 2011

I made a wood center console cover out of oak. The original one broke off. First I cut out the rectangle and rounded the front edges with a jigsaw. Then I straightened the sides with a file. Then I sanded the whole thing.
